Mahendra Singh Dhoni, also referred to as “Captain Cool,” is a highly respected figure in Indian cricket. A Ranchi native, Dhoni has shown exceptional cricketing ability and unrivalled leadership abilities throughout his career. Recognised for his calm demeanour and astute decisions on the pitch, he has guided the Indian cricket team to several victories, including the 2013 ICC Champions Trophy, the 2011 ICC Cricket World Cup, and the 2007 ICC World Twenty20. Cricket fans all across the world admire him for his ability to remain calm under pressure and deliver game-winning performances when it counts the most.

Yuvraj Singh, also known as “Yuvi” is an enduring symbol of cricketing prowess and determination in India. Yuvraj’s journey has been nothing short of legendary, beginning in the heart of the country’s cricketing passion. He has captivated cricket fans all around the world with his daring batting style and dynamic all-round abilities. He has been an active part of India’s wins in international championships, most notably the 2011 ICC World Cup. In addition to his on-field accomplishments, his courageous battle with cancer has been a beacon of light for cancer survivors across the globe.
